Output 57f03a6456d65de03c7bab96a2d9b51f74d9d9a98aab2d982c0f519d56a695bf:0

value
1038527952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bab056025cef58e09d32ad86531cd542f180c552 OP_EQUALVERIFY OP_CHECKSIG
address
1J27viggiWpvSBSSpKybQPEsgwJszchEWd
transaction
57f03a6456d65de03c7bab96a2d9b51f74d9d9a98aab2d982c0f519d56a695bf
confirmations
420693
spent
true